This maybe wxWidgets fault but pgadmin sure is using a lot of GDI 
objects. It releases them ok when you close different windows but it 
seems to allocating way more then would seem necessary. I do a lot of 
postgres related development at work and I have to setup pgadmin on a 
lot of slower windows machines, and those GDI objects are very precious 
to me. With only 5 windows open, its possible to run almost completely 
out. Visual Studio is another beast but not as bad as pgadmin with 4 
windows open. Any clue where and when in wxwidgets (I'm more of gtk and 
cocoa developer so I don't know) those GDI objects get allocated and if 
anyone knows if this is related more to wxWidgets (maybe something I 
could rebuild myself with a different backend or something) or the code 
in general?
